How What Police Lines Indicate a Serious Situation Actually Works

To understand what police lines indicate a serious situation, it helps to think of them as temporary visual tools used by agencies to organize space during an unfolding event. Police tape, barricades, and designated boundary lines serve to separate the public from areas where officers are actively working. These markers do not automatically confirm the exact nature of an emergency, but they do communicate that officials have assessed the scene and established a controlled perimeter. The presence of visible boundaries often correlates with incident command protocols that prioritize safety, evidence integrity, and coordinated response efforts.

In practice, when you observe what police lines indicate a serious situation at a street corner or public venue, several standard procedures are likely in play. Officers may be preserving potential evidence, ensuring witness statements are collected systematically, or coordinating with specialized units. The type and placement of barriers can vary, from simple reflective tape to fully enforced road closures depending on the scope of the incident. Understanding that these lines exist to manage flow and risk can help you interpret the scene accurately and make safe, respectful decisions about proximity and movement.

Many people ask whether what police lines indicate a serious situation always means that a crime has occurred. The short answer is no; these boundaries can be used for traffic incidents, medical emergencies, public safety operations, or large-scale gatherings that require controlled access. Officers deploy barriers whenever they need to safeguard a specific area, protect ongoing work, or prevent interference with investigations. Recognizing that lines are a tool for orderly management rather than a public alarm can ease unnecessary anxiety while still encouraging situational awareness.

Another common question revolves around how the public should react when encountering what police lines indicate a serious situation. Staying a safe distance away, following officer instructions, and avoiding attempts to move or step over barriers are basic guidelines that apply across jurisdictions. Recording from a respectful vantage point is generally acceptable as long as it does not interfere with operations or compromise privacy where legally protected. By staying informed and observant, individuals can support public safety goals without inserting themselves into active scenes.

Things People Often Misunderstand

A prevalent misconception is that any use of police tape immediately signifies a violent crime or fatality, when in reality these lines serve many routine purposes. Misunderstandings also arise when individuals assume that barriers mean an area is permanently dangerous, while in fact they are temporary measures tied to specific operations. Another myth involves the belief that the public cannot or should not observe scenes marked by police lines, when lawful documentation and respectful viewing remain part of community engagement. Correcting these myths through transparent explanations helps build trust between residents and public safety institutions.
